Your inventory is always full in The Witcher 3 because the game has a weight limit and carry capacity, which can be easily exceeded by collecting numerous items, weapons, and armor throughout the game, and not regularly selling or dismantling them to free up space, especially since junk items and items under Weapons & Armor and Roach also carry weight that adds to the total capacity. To manage this, it’s essential to regularly review your inventory, sell unwanted items to merchants, use Saddlebags for Roach to increase carry capacity, and utilize Stash Chests found in various locations like White Orchard, Velen, Novigrad, and Skellige to store items safely without them being stolen.
Managing Inventory Space
To avoid a full inventory, understanding how to manage your space effectively is crucial. This includes knowing what to keep, what to sell, and how to increase your carry capacity. Regularly dismantling junk items and selling items you no longer need can significantly reduce the weight in your inventory.
FAQs
Below are some frequently asked questions related to managing your inventory in The Witcher 3:
- How do I clear my inventory in Witcher 3?
- Clearing your inventory involves selling items you don’t need to merchants, dismantling junk, and storing items in Stash Chests. Prioritize keeping Witcher gear and essential items.
- How do I increase my inventory space in Witcher 3?
- You can increase your inventory space by purchasing Saddlebags for Roach, which can be found at various merchants or won from horse races.
- Is there a stash limit in The Witcher 3?
- As of the current game version, there is no limit to the stash, allowing you to store as many items as you wish without worrying about them being stolen.
- What is Max inventory in Witcher 3?
- The maximum inventory weight limit is 250, and using the Fiend Decoction can increase this limit by 20.
- Should you dismantle or sell in Witcher 3?
- Generally, selling is more beneficial as it yields more gold, which can be used to purchase necessary items or craft Witcher gear.
- Should I keep junk or sell Witcher 3?
- It’s advisable to either sell or dismantle junk items to reduce weight and free up inventory space, as they serve no practical purpose otherwise.
- Can your stash be stolen in The Witcher 3?
- No, items stored in your stash are safe and cannot be stolen, providing a secure way to store your items.
